visszafordult
Visszafordult is a Hungarian intransitive verb meaning turned back or turned around. It is the past tense form of visszafordul, a compound verb created from the prefix vissza- (“back”) and the verb fordul (“to turn”). The form conveys that the subject changed direction and returned toward the original position.
In literal use, visszafordult describes a physical turning: a person or object changes course and moves back.
